Before you come

  1. 1 week before

    No new retinoids, exfoliating acids, or waxing on the treatment area. Disclose any new prescriptions — especially blood thinners or isotretinoin.

  2. 24 hours

    Skip alcohol and NSAIDs (ibuprofen, aspirin) if injectables are possible. Tylenol is fine. Eat something light on the day of.

  3. Day of

    Arrive 10 minutes early. Bring photo ID and a credit card (held on file, not charged unless you approve). Clean skin if possible — we have remover if not.

  4. What to bring

    A list of current medications, supplements, and allergies. Optional: photos of past treatments or results you'd like to discuss.

Will I look "done" right away?

No. Botox settles at 14 days. Fillers look most natural at 2 weeks once swelling subsides. HydraFacial glows immediately. Lasers and microneedling reveal over weeks. Patience reads as elegance.
